A set of nodejs tools to take a current snapshot and deploy tokens on the EOS network
- Install Nodejs
- Clone this repository
- Run
npm install
-
Update
takeNames.js
,takeSnapshot.js
, andpaySnapshot.js
with your preferred eos node connection -
Update
takeSnapshot.js
by settingairgrab = 'yourairgrabtoken'
orairgrab=false
-
Update
paySnapshot.js
by settingairdropConfig
as appropriate -
-
Get the most recent complete snapshot from https://www.eossnapshots.io/ by EOS New York
Change the csv to a single column of names and rename it
names.csv
(These snapshots grab every account on EOS)
-
or Run
node takesNames.js
.This tool only gets names from the "voters table" of EOS... meaning they are either a genesis account or have voted for a block producer or proxy.
If you don't pause blocks you may get duplicate names. Remove duplicates in excel or file editor. Rename the
names-timestamp.csv
tonames.csv
-
-
Run
node takeSnapshot.js
. This will take a while. -
Review
snapshot-timestamp.csv
and create a new filesnapshot.csv
in the following format:account name,quantity
quantity should be just a number, no precision or symbol neccessary -
Finally, run
node paysnapShot.js
.If you want to run a test be sure to set broadcast: false and uncomment mockTransactions => 'pass'
-
Review
payment-timestamp.csv
to confirm the deployment went out to everyone desired.
